Newton County, Georgia Population by Race & Ethnicity
| Race / Ethnicity | Population | Percentage |
|---|---|---|
| Black / African American | 55,841 | 47.3% |
| White (Non-Hispanic) | 45,832 | 38.8% |
| Hispanic or Latino | 8,435 | 7.1% |
| Two or More Races | 5,897 | 5.0% |
| Asian | 1,791 | 1.5% |
| Other Race | 292 | 0.2% |
| Native American | 64 | 0.1% |
| Pacific Islander | 0 | 0.0% |
